1) Old-fashioned bleeding heart in English is the name of a plant defined with Dicentra spectabilis in various botanical sources. This page contains potential references in Ayurveda, modern medicine, and other folk traditions or local practices It has the synonym Dielytra spectabilis (L.) DC. (among others).

2) Old-fashioned bleeding heart is also identified with Lamprocapnos spectabilis It has the synonym Capnorchis spectabilis (L.) Borkh. (etc.).
